We sailed Ambassador Cruise Line's newest ship, Ambition, for a 6 night Spring Getaway cruise in April 2024. We stayed in cabin 9208, which is a superior plus twin cabin located towards the aft of deck 9. In this video we give you a tour of the cabin and talk you through our experience of staying in it for 6 nights. Ambition started sailing with ambassador in May 2023, and originally sailed as Mistral for Festival Cruises. She has sailed under Ibero, Costa and Aida Cruises before her move to Ambassador.
